Understanding SWOT Analysis

SWOT analysis is a strategic management tool designed to help businesses assess their internal and external environments. The acronym stands for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ities, and Threats. By evaluating these four key areas, companies can make informed decisions and craft effective strategies.

  1. Strengths: These are internal attributes that give your business a competitive edge. Strengths might include a strong brand reputation, a loyal customer base, unique technology, or a talented workforce. Recognizing these strengths allows you to leverage them for growth and competitive advantage.

  2. Weaknesses: Internal factors that may place your business at a disadvantage. Weaknesses could be limited resources, skill gaps, or a lacklustre brand reputation. Identifying weaknesses is crucial for addressing them proactively and mitigating their impact.

  3. Opportunities: External factors that could benefit your business if leveraged effectively. Opportunities might include emerging market trends, technological advancements, or shifts in consumer behaviour. Recognizing opportunities helps align your strategy to seize these favourable conditions.

  4. Threats: External challenges that could pose risks to your business. These might include economic downturns, increased competition, or regulatory changes. Understanding threats enables you to develop strategies to mitigate potential negative impacts.

The SWOT Analysis Process

To make the most of SWOT analysis, follow this structured approach:

  1. Preparation: Assemble a diverse team from various departments to gather a comprehensive perspective. Collect relevant data such as market research, financial reports, and customer feedback.

  2. Brainstorming: Conduct brainstorming sessions to identify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ities, and Threats. Encourage open and honest discussions to uncover valuable insights.

  3. Analysis: Organize and prioritize the identified factors. Assess how each Strength and Weakness affects your ability to capitalize on opportunities or defend against Threats.

  4. Strategy Development: Use insights from your SWOT analysis to craft strategic initiatives. For example, leverage Strengths to take advantage of Opportunities, or address Weaknesses to minimize Threats.

  5. Implementation and Monitoring: Execute your strategies and monitor their effectiveness continuously. Be ready to adjust your approach based on new insights or changes in the business environment.

Key Insights for Effective SWOT Analysis

  1. Be Objective: Aim for a balanced evaluation of your business. Avoid overstating strengths or downplaying weaknesses. An honest assessment is essential for developing actionable strategies.

  2. Stay Current: Regularly update your SWOT analysis to reflect changes in the market or your business. An outdated analysis can lead to missed opportunities or unaddressed threats.

  3. Involve Key Stakeholders: Engage various stakeholders, including employees, customers, and industry experts. Diverse perspectives can reveal insights that might otherwise be overlooked.

  4. Focus on Actionable Insights: Ensure that the findings from your SWOT analysis translate into practical strategies. Prioritize initiatives that align with your business goals and can deliver tangible results.

  5. Integrate with Strategic Planning: Use your SWOT analysis as a foundation for broader strategic planning. Align your business objectives and initiatives with the insights gained from the analysis.

Expert Tips for Maximizing SWOT Analysis

  1. Utilize SWOT Analysis Software: Consider using tools and software to streamline the SWOT analysis process and visualize your findings more effectively.

  2. Benchmark Against Competitors: Compare your SWOT analysis with your competitors to gain insights into your relative position and identify areas for improvement.

  3. Scenario Planning: Incorporate different future scenarios into your SWOT analysis to anticipate how changes might impact your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ities, and Threats.

  4. Regular Reviews: Make SWOT analysis a routine part of your strategic planning. Schedule periodic reviews to keep your analysis relevant and responsive to evolving business dynamics.

  5. Leverage Insights Across Departments: Share the results of your SWOT analysis across departments to ensure alignment and foster a collaborative approach to strategy implementation.
